Ingredients for Hearty Crock Pot Beef Stew Recipe
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ious Hearty Crock Pot Beef Stew Recipe:
2 ½ pounds stew meat – Choose well-marbled cuts like chuck for the best flavor and tenderness as they cook down.
½ teaspoon black pepper – This adds a gentle kick; feel free to adjust to your taste.
½ teaspoon garlic salt – Enhances the meat with that essential garlic flavor.
½ teaspoon celery salt – For a unique, savory dimension that lifts the entire dish.
1/4 cup flour – This helps in browning the meat and thickening the stew effectively.
3-6 tablespoons olive oil – Use a good quality olive oil for sautéing the meat and enhancing flavors.
3 tablespoons cold butter, divided – This will enrich the stew’s finish and give it that professional touch.
2 cups yellow onions, diced – Sweet onions add depth; aim for evenly diced pieces for uniform cooking.
4 cloves garlic, minced – Always use fresh garlic if possible; the aroma is unbeatable.
1 cup cabernet sauvignon or merlot – A splash of red wine brings richness and a complex note to the broth.
4 cups beef broth – Essential for the stew’s foundation; opt for low-sodium if watching salt intake.
2 beef bouillon cubes – These intensify the beef flavor further; dissolve in your broth for maximum impact.
2 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ce – Adds a tangy, umami kick that elevates the dish.
3 tablespoons tomato paste – This adds both color and a richness that makes the broth unforgettable.
5 medium carrots, cut into 1-inch chunks – Carrots add sweetness and color; slice them to matching sizes for even cooking.
1 lb. baby Yukon gold potatoes, halved or quartered – These creamy potatoes hold their shape well; no need to peel them!
2 bay leaves – Just like a hug for the stew, they impart a subtle aroma that enhances flavors.
1 sprig rosemary – A fresh herb adds a fragrant note—tie it with string for easy removal later.
1 cup frozen peas – Add these during the final minutes for a pop of color and sweetness.
1/4 cup cold water (optional) – Use this if thickening is needed towards the end of cooking.
3 tablespoons corn starch (optional) – Mix with water to thicken if desired, creating a satisfying texture.
2-3 drops Gravy Master (optional) – A dash at the end will deepen the color and flavor if you’re feeling fancy.
How to Make Hearty Crock Pot Beef Stew Recipe
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ious Hearty Crock Pot Beef Stew Recipe:
Step 1: Prepare the Meat
Cut the stew meat into 1-inch cubes, being sure to discard any large chunks of fat. Pat them dry with paper towels to help them brown better.
Step 2: Season and Flour the Meat
In a bowl, toss the seasoned beef with black pepper, garlic salt, and celery salt. Sprinkle the flour over the meat and toss it again to coat each piece well.
Step 3: Brown the Meat
Heat 3 tablespoons of ol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the beef in batches, being careful not to overcrowd the pan. Sear the meat on all sides for about 45 seconds before transferring it to the slow cooker.
Step 4: Sauté the Aromatics
Reduce the heat to medium and add 1 tablespoon of cold butter to the skillet. Add the diced onions and sauté for 5 minutes until softened.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ute. Pour in a splash of wine to deglaze the pan, scraping up any delicious brown bits, then transfer this mixture to the slow cooker.
Step 5: Combine All Ingredients
Add the beef broth, bouillon cubes, Worcestershire sauce, tomato paste, carrots, potatoes, bay leaves, and rosemary to the slow cooker. Give it all a good stir to mix everything together.
Step 6: Let It Cook
Cover the slow cooker and cook on low for 7 ½ to 8 hours or high for 3½ to 4 hours. The vegetables should be tender, and the beef fork-tender.
Add the frozen peas during the last 15 minutes of cooking time. Before serving, remove the bay leaves and rosemary stem.
For thicker stew, you can mix ¼ cup cold water with 3 tablespoons cornstarch, then stir it into the stew gradually. Turn off the heat and swirl in the remaining 2 tablespoons of cold butter for that rich, creamy finish. If feeling adventurous, a few drops of Gravy Master can make your stew even more visually enticing.

How do I store and reheat Hearty Crock Pot Beef Stew?
To store your Hearty Crock Pot Beef Stew, let it cool completely before placing it in an airtight container and refrigerating. It can safely be stored in the fridge for up to four days or frozen for up to three months. When reheating, warm it slowly on the stovetop over low heat, adding a splash of beef broth if needed to maintain its rich consistency.
